0

ヘッドセクションに次のタグが付いたSharePointマスターページがあります。

<META HTTP-EQUIV = "Expires" content = "-1">
<META HTTP-EQUIV = "Pragma" CONTENT = "no-cache">
<META HTTP-EQUIV = "Cache-Control" CONTENT = "no-cache">
<META HTTP-EQUIV = "Cache-Control" CONTENT = "private">
<META HTTP-EQUIV = "Cache-Control" CONTENT = "no-store">

これらすべてを持っているという事実にもかかわらず、そのマスターページを使用する私のページの応答は、Fiddlerで常に「cache-control:private」と表示されます。私も試しました

<META HTTP-EQUIV = "Cache-Control" CONTENT = "no-store、no-cache、private">

同じ効果で。私は何が間違っているのですか?

編集:IISのWebアプリケーション設定でもこれらを設定しようとしましたが、役に立ちませんでした。

4

1 に答える 1

1

<meta http-equiv="..." content="...">タグは、HTTP 経由でクライアントに送信される前に、サーバーによって解析されません。Fiddler は HTTP トラフィックを厳密に調べます。これらの> タグは、 HTTP 経由で転送された後<meta、Web ブラウザーによって解析されます。

于 2009-12-17T19:34:21.697 に答える